1. Evaluation Methodology

The “Evaluation Methodology” is a elementary determinant of what data might be gleaned from a blood pattern. It dictates the particular substances or traits that may be measured and straight influences the diagnostic and monitoring capabilities of any process that attracts data from a blood pattern.

  • Spectrophotometry

    Spectrophotometry entails measuring the absorbance or transmission of sunshine by means of a blood pattern. That is usually used to quantify the focus of particular molecules, similar to hemoglobin or bilirubin. Variations in mild absorbance can point out abnormalities in these compounds, aiding within the prognosis of anemia or liver problems.

  • Immunoassay

    Immunoassays depend on the particular binding of antibodies to focus on molecules (antigens) within the blood. Strategies like ELISA (Enzyme-Linked Immunosorbent Assay) are used to detect and quantify antibodies or antigens, essential for diagnosing infections, autoimmune illnesses, and monitoring hormone ranges. For instance, an ELISA could be used to detect antibodies towards a particular virus, indicating a previous or present an infection.

  • Stream Cytometry

    Stream cytometry analyzes particular person cells inside a blood pattern primarily based on their bodily and chemical traits. Cells are stained with fluorescent markers that bind to particular cell floor proteins. This permits for the identification and counting of various cell populations, similar to T cells or B cells, which is significant in diagnosing leukemia, lymphoma, and immune deficiencies.

  • Molecular Diagnostics (PCR)

    Molecular diagnostic strategies, similar to Polymerase Chain Response (PCR), amplify and detect particular DNA or RNA sequences inside a blood pattern. That is significantly helpful for figuring out infectious brokers (viruses, micro organism) or detecting genetic mutations related to sure illnesses. PCR can be utilized to detect the presence of minimal residual illness in most cancers sufferers or to establish particular bacterial strains inflicting an an infection.

The collection of a specific analytical methodology is pushed by the medical query being requested. Every methodology has inherent strengths and limitations, impacting sensitivity, specificity, and turnaround time. The selection of methodology, due to this fact, straight influences the power to precisely diagnose and handle a affected person’s situation primarily based on the blood pattern evaluation.

2. Pattern Assortment

The integrity of knowledge derived from any process that analyzes blood hinges critically on the strategy of pattern assortment. Improper assortment strategies can introduce errors that compromise the validity of take a look at outcomes, resulting in inaccurate diagnoses or inappropriate remedy selections. The phlebotomist’s ability in acquiring a clear, consultant pattern is, due to this fact, a foundational factor within the total analytical course of that analyzes a blood pattern.

As an illustration, if a blood pattern is collected utilizing a contaminated needle or tube, the introduction of overseas substances can skew the outcomes of the evaluation. Equally, insufficient mixing of the blood with anticoagulant can result in clot formation, rendering the pattern unusable or producing misguided readings. The selection of assortment tube can be paramount; totally different tubes comprise totally different components (e.g., EDTA, heparin, citrate) which are particular to the kind of evaluation to be carried out. Utilizing the mistaken tube can intrude with the evaluation and produce unreliable information. For instance, an electrolyte panel requires a serum separator tube to stop interference from mobile parts, whereas a whole blood depend (CBC) necessitates an EDTA tube to stop clotting. Failure to stick to those tips can compromise the take a look at’s integrity.

In abstract, meticulous adherence to standardized protocols throughout pattern assortment is indispensable for guaranteeing the accuracy and reliability of any process that analyzes a blood pattern. Components similar to approach, gear, and the selection of assortment tubes have to be fastidiously thought of and managed to reduce the potential for pre-analytical errors that may impression downstream outcomes and in the end have an effect on affected person care.

4. Reference Vary

The reference vary is a important parameter in decoding the outcomes derived from any process that entails a blood pattern. It supplies a benchmark towards which a person’s outcomes are in contrast, enabling clinicians to find out whether or not these outcomes fall inside anticipated physiological limits. The institution and correct utility of reference ranges are, due to this fact, important for correct prognosis and efficient affected person administration each time a blood pattern is analyzed.

  • Inhabitants-Particular Variations

    Reference ranges are sometimes population-specific, reflecting variations primarily based on elements similar to age, intercourse, ethnicity, and geographic location. For instance, hemoglobin ranges could differ between women and men as a result of hormonal influences, necessitating separate reference ranges for every group. Equally, reference ranges for sure analytes could differ primarily based on altitude or dietary habits. Failure to contemplate these population-specific variations can result in misinterpretation of outcomes and inappropriate medical selections.

  • Methodology-Dependent Values

    Reference ranges are intrinsically linked to the particular analytical methodology used to carry out the evaluation. Totally different laboratories could make use of totally different strategies or devices, every with its personal inherent variability. Consequently, reference ranges have to be established and validated for every particular methodology used. The usage of an inappropriate reference vary may end up in important errors in interpretation. As an illustration, a consequence thought of regular utilizing one methodology’s reference vary could be flagged as irregular in comparison towards the reference vary established for a unique methodology.

  • Scientific Significance and Interpretation

    Whereas reference ranges present a statistical framework for decoding outcomes, it’s essential to acknowledge {that a} consequence falling outdoors the reference vary doesn’t routinely point out illness. Conversely, a consequence inside the reference vary doesn’t essentially exclude pathology. Scientific significance have to be decided along with the affected person’s medical historical past, bodily examination findings, and different related diagnostic data. Contextual interpretation is crucial to keep away from over- or under-diagnosis primarily based solely on numerical values obtained from evaluation of a blood pattern.

  • Periodic Evaluation and Updates

    Reference ranges needs to be periodically reviewed and up to date to mirror modifications in inhabitants demographics, analytical methodologies, and evolving medical understanding. As new information emerges and laboratory practices evolve, the established reference ranges could should be adjusted to keep up their accuracy and relevance. Common evaluate ensures that the reference ranges used stay present and applicable for the affected person inhabitants being served by a particular process used for a blood pattern.

In conclusion, the reference vary supplies an important context for decoding outcomes derived from procedures that contain analyzing a blood pattern. Consideration of population-specific variations, methodology-dependent values, medical significance, and the necessity for periodic evaluate are all important for guaranteeing the correct and efficient utility of reference ranges in medical apply. Correct and complete utility ensures applicable medical motion is taken primarily based on any process that attracts data from a blood pattern.

6. Accuracy/Precision

Accuracy and precision are elementary attributes of any analytical process, together with these carried out on blood samples. Accuracy refers back to the closeness of a measured worth to the true worth of the substance being measured. Precision, however, describes the repeatability or reproducibility of a measurement. A process analyzing a blood pattern might be exact (yielding comparable outcomes upon repeated testing), but inaccurate (constantly deviating from the true worth). Conversely, a process could also be correct on common, however lack precision, with particular person outcomes exhibiting important variability. Each attributes are essential for the reliability and medical utility of the outcomes.

The accuracy and precision of procedures that analyze a blood pattern are affected by numerous elements, together with the standard of reagents, the calibration of devices, and the technical experience of personnel. Inaccurate outcomes can result in misdiagnosis, inappropriate remedy selections, and adversarial affected person outcomes. For instance, an inaccurate measurement of blood glucose ranges may lead to incorrect insulin dosing for a diabetic affected person. Equally, imprecise measurements of cardiac enzymes may delay or stop the well timed prognosis of a myocardial infarction. High quality management measures, similar to using management samples with identified values, are important for monitoring and sustaining accuracy and precision. Common calibration of devices and ongoing coaching of personnel are additionally important.

In abstract, accuracy and precision are non-negotiable attributes of any process analyzing a blood pattern. These traits make sure the reliability and medical relevance of take a look at outcomes. Rigorous high quality management measures, correct instrument calibration, and expert personnel are important for attaining and sustaining acceptable ranges of accuracy and precision, thereby minimizing the danger of diagnostic errors and enhancing affected person care.

7. High quality Management

High quality management is an indispensable factor in guaranteeing the reliability and validity of any process utilizing a blood pattern. Its implementation minimizes errors and biases all through the complete analytical course of, from pre-analytical phases (pattern assortment, dealing with, and storage) to analytical phases (precise testing) and post-analytical phases (consequence reporting and interpretation). With out stringent high quality management measures, the medical utility of knowledge from any process involving a blood pattern is severely compromised, probably resulting in misdiagnosis and inappropriate medical interventions. For instance, a flawed blood depend as a result of poor high quality management may result in pointless antibiotic administration, contributing to antibiotic resistance and affected person hurt.

A sturdy high quality management program incorporates a number of key parts. These embrace using licensed reference supplies to calibrate devices, common proficiency testing to evaluate the competency of laboratory personnel, and the implementation of standardized working procedures to reduce variability. Inner high quality management entails the routine evaluation of management samples with identified values alongside affected person specimens, permitting for the real-time detection of systematic or random errors. Exterior high quality evaluation packages, provided by impartial organizations, present an goal analysis of a laboratory’s efficiency in comparison with its friends. Such packages establish areas for enchancment and be sure that laboratory practices align with finest practices.

In abstract, high quality management serves as a cornerstone in sustaining the integrity of knowledge from blood samples. It isn’t merely a regulatory requirement however an moral crucial that safeguards affected person security and ensures the correct supply of healthcare. Steady monitoring, rigorous adherence to standardized protocols, and proactive identification of potential sources of error are important for upholding the standard and reliability of the analytical procedures utilizing blood samples, thereby maximizing their medical utility and minimizing the danger of adversarial outcomes.
